"The Watch"
Spoiler!
Although not much is known about them,we do know that The Watch is an elite organization of time traveling beings. Only the best of the best were allowed to join, making them a deadly threat if you where to ever encounter them. It isn't known who runs the fleet, due to the fact that no one has met them personally. The main empires of Centaurus A (NGC 5128) have given The Watch's ships names after past watch manufactures, which were fitting for the group's name.
All of The Watch's ships were fitted with modified Dieterlings, that were integrated with there ES 137-001's (time traveling machines).
